Job description

Intern (MSW) - Behavioral Health – Grand Forks, ND

Horizon Health is seeking a Intern (MSW) for our BRAND NEW unit called Altru Behavioral Health Center in Grand Forks, ND. This unit will be a 24 bed inpatient unit for both adult and pediatric patients. We are also planning to expand to an additional 24 beds in 2026. Altru Health System and Universal Health Services are working together in expanding inpatient behavioral health services. The MSW Student Intern provides supervised, hands‑on experience in clinical social work practice, applying classroom learning to real-world settings. Interns work alongside licensed clinicians and interdisciplinary teams to support individuals, families, and communities, developing skills in psychosocial assessment, treatment planning, counseling, and care coordination.

Who we are & where you can make a difference

Quality care is our passion; improving lives is our reward. Horizon Health Behavioral Health Services, a subsidiary of Universal Health Services, is a leading behavioral services management company. Horizon Health Behavioral Health Services has been leading the way in partnering with hospitals to manage their behavioral health programs for over 40 years. With an unparalleled breadth of services, Horizon Health Behavioral Health Services has singular expertise in behavioral health conditions and comprehensive care settings. Whether it involves the planning, development and implementation of a new behavioral health service line, or the successful management of an existing behavioral health service, Horizon Health Behavioral Health Services has extensive expertise in successfully addressing concerns unique to hospital-based programs.

About Universal Health Services

Headquartered in King of Prussia, PA, Universal Health Services, Inc. (NYSE: UHS) is one of the nation’s largest and most respected providers of hospital and healthcare services. Since our founding in 1979, UHS has grown steadily into a premier Fortune 500® corporation perennially recognized by multiple esteemed national rating entities. Through its subsidiaries, UHS operates inpatient acute care facilities, inpatient behavioral health facilities, outpatient and other facilities, nationwide virtual behavioral health services, an insurance offering, a physician network and various related services with physical locations in the U.S., Puerto Rico, Ireland and United Kingdom. www.uhs.com.
